Plummeting inflation to keep Angus rent increase pegged back to 2% for 2021/22 © Alf Jonsson/imageBROKER/Shutters Tumbling inflation during the pandemic is set to see a lower than usual rise in Angus Council house rents. Housing chiefs are recommending a 2% rise for 2021/22 in a plan going before communities councillors on Tuesday. It would take the average weekly Angus council house rent to £72.28.
